Jewellery and silver from the museum collection.

Following the documentation of the museum’s historic jewellery collection by Margaret Wirepa it was decided that a selection of jewellery from the collection would be exhibited. Margaret Wirepa and Margaret Mettner have selected 27 items of jewellery for the exhibition, half of which come from the Lysnar Collection gifted to the museum in 1955. The selected treasures include brooches, necklaces, cameos, an agate pill box, and a locket. The oldest item in the exhibition is a gold watch and key dating to 1828. Twelve sterling silver accessories for men have been selected by Tony Field from the museum’s silver collection to be exhibited with the jewellery. These items include sovereign cases, match cases and propelling pencils.

The cameo brooch illustrated above is from the Lysnar Collection and is dated circa 1880.
